John Körmeling

Boulevard Scheveningen

For the seaside location on Scheveningen boulevard the artist John Körmeling (Eindhoven) has designed a pavilion which looks somewhat like a pre-war petrol station. The little building is equipped with a marquee with room for a bicycle repair shop. An efficiently furnished office space offers a view in all directions. The roof's edge is decorated with typical ‘bicycle words' like pedal, fresh air and spoke in little flickering lights.
